Italian software developer Ilexsoft on Monday released HighDesign v1.1, a new version of their CAD and illustration package for the Mac. The new release gains more than 30 new features, according to the developer, including support for Mac OS X v10.3 “Panther.”
HighDesign is a 2D Computer Aided Design (CAD) and illustration program that sports vector tools and other technology designed to help designers. The software supports multiple sheets and layers, support for ISO, ASME and custom page layouts, customizable line-types and hatch patterns, and dozens of other features.
Other new features include support for Quartz anti-aliasing and adjustable fill transparency; a new Edit toolbar to simplify use of editing functions; a new Print Area tool; enhanced Dimension tool; auto page scrolling; improved linear and angular unit handling; faster snap to objects; improved DXF file compatibility and new symbol libraries.
HighDesign v1.1 is a free update for registered users. HighDesign v1.1 is available in Professional (US$349.95) and Standard ($149.95) versions. More details are available from the Web site.
